The project involved curating a Pre-Valentine experiential event at Otoki, designed as an intimate Sushi and Sake Workshop for members of FICCI FLO Mumbai.

The event aimed to introduce Otoki to a high-value audience of entrepreneurs and HNIs, while creating an immersive cultural experience centered around Japanese cuisine. The workshop was led by Chef Mohit, offering guests an opportunity to engage directly with the culinary process while learning about sushi preparation and sake.

The workshop included:

• Sushi-making demonstration and interactive session led by Chef Mohit

• Conversation on Japanese cuisine and cultural myths led by Pranav Rungta and Anurag Kartiar

• Sake workshop and tasting experience

• Networking session over sushi and sake

Event Details

Event: Pre-Valentine Soiree – Sushi & Sake Workshop

Date: 11 February 2026 | Time: 5:00 PM – 7:30 PM | Venue: Otoki

Key Participants

Pranav Rungta | Anurag Kartiar | Chef Mohit

Attendance & Guest Profile

Total Attendance: 30 members from FICCI FLO Mumbai

Audience Profile

• Age Group: 35–70 years

• Occupation: Entrepreneurs, business owners, HNIs

• Lifestyle: Affluent, well-travelled, interested in culture, art, and wellness experiences

Event Flow

5:00 – 5:30 PM: Guest arrivals and networking over high tea

5:30 – 5:45 PM: Introduction to the collaboration by Pranav Rungta and Megha from FICCI FLO

5:45 – 6:15 PM: Sushi-making workshop and culinary briefing by Chef Mohit

6:15 – 6:30 PM: Conversation on myths and cultural nuances of Japanese cuisine

6:30 – 7:00 PM: Sake workshop and tasting session

7:00 – 7:30 PM: Networking and dining experience with sushi and sake

Results

Successful engagement with 30 high-value guests from an influential business community.

Strong brand exposure for Otoki among affluent and well-connected audiences.

High guest participation during the interactive sushi-making and sake workshop.

Positive networking environment leading to potential repeat visits and word-of-mouth promotion.

Post-event digital amplification through social media stories and brand mentions.

Initiated discussions with FICCI FLO for a potential second edition of the event.
